Browsing delavan, United Kingdom business
6568 Anderson Dr | Delavan, 53115
N4734 County Road M | Delavan, 53115
1624 Hobbs DRIVE, Suite 1 | Delavan, 53115
1819 E Geneva St | Delavan, 53115
820 E Geneva St | Delavan, 53115
1221 S Shore Dr | Delavan, 53115
104 N 5th St | Delavan, 53115
119 Park Pl | Delavan, 53115
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ood